Bill Sponsors: IN HB1005 | 2017 | Regular Session

Bill Title: Superintendent of public instruction. Abolishes the office of the state superintendent of public instruction on January 10, 2025. Provides that, after January 10, 2025, the governor shall appoint a secretary of education. Establishes residency, education, and experience qualifications for the secretary of education. Makes conforming and technical amendments.

Spectrum: Moderate Partisan Bill (Republican 5-1)

Status: (Passed) 2017-04-27 - Public Law 219 [HB1005 Detail]
